ILF For more than 20 years, the ILF has been offering an excellent Master of Laws in Finance program in English with a truly international and EU focus. The interdisciplinary curriculum covers areas in law, business and economics and adopts a very practical approach taught by many expert practitioners from leading international law firms, finance and banking specialists as well as officials of the ECB, German Bundesbank etc. Mandatory internships are offered at these institutions in Frankfurt.

Goethe Frankfurt The European Academy of Legal Theory offers a one-year advanced Master's Course in Legal Theory in English. Participants will study at one or more partner universities. The Academy's LLM-Programme in Legal Theory is hosted at Goethe-University Frankfurt am Main. It starts every year in October and welcomes applicants from all over the world holding a basic law degree or a basic degree in a subject related to legal theory and having completed one year of professional and/or research experience.
